Motorola Edge 50 Pro has officially launched, bringing top-tier features like a curved P-OLED display, ultra-fast charging, and refined aesthetics to the mid-range market. With a focus on design and speed, this device is aimed at users who want premium feel without flagship pricing.
Eye-Catching Curved Display
The Motorola Edge 50 Pro features a 6.7-inch curved P-OLED display with 1.5K resolution and a smooth 144Hz refresh rate. The panel supports HDR10+ and boasts Pantone-validated color accuracy, offering immersive visuals for streaming and gaming.
Blazing-Fast 125W Charging
Equipped with a 4,500mAh battery, the Edge 50 Pro supports 125W TurboPower charging. It can go from 0 to 100% in under 20 minutes, making it ideal for users on the move. Wireless charging up to 50W is also supported.
Sleek and Premium Build
The phone is available in three eye-catching finishes—Black Beauty, Luxe Lavender, and Moonlight Pearl. A vegan leather back and matte aluminum frame give it a premium look and comfortable in-hand feel.
Balanced Performance Setup
Powered by the Snapdragon 7 Gen 3 chipset, the Edge 50 Pro comes with up to 12GB RAM and 256GB storage. While not a gaming powerhouse, it handles daily tasks with ease and keeps multitasking smooth.
Camera and Software Experience
It sports a triple-camera setup: 50MP main, 13MP ultrawide, and 10MP telephoto with OIS. The front houses a sharp 50MP selfie shooter. Motorola’s Hello UI offers a clean Android 14 experience with promised OS and security updates.
